Therefore, toget rid of the adversely ingredients from natural medicine has a very important significance todrug treatment of human disease.Preliminary studies show that the extracts from Vaccaria which showed the inhibition ofneo-vascularization contain ingredients substance of angiogenesis. Firstly, thin layerchromatography separation techniques were used to separate the extracts of Vaccaria. By thephysical and chemical properties and cell activity detection, we can determine that Vaccariaflavonoid glycosides promote endothelial cells generated while the total saponins of Vaccariawere the inhibit angiogenesis compound. And a method of determination the total saponinsfrom Vaccaria was established.There are three kinds of method were showed in this paper to give an extraction of totalsaponins from Vaccaria. Ultrasonic extraction, ethanol reflux extraction and the boiled alcoholprecipitation extraction method. Take the dry powder yield and total saponins content ascomprehensive evaluation, ethanol reflux extraction was choose as the better method toextract the total saponins from Vaccaria.Macro porous resin was used to separate the two types of components which have theopposite effect to neo-vascularization, and HPD-100macro porous resin was chosen as agood method to separate the total saponins from flavones glycoside in Vaccaria extracts.
